Biometric Authentication in Banking Security

Biometric authentication is transforming banking security by replacing passwords with unique biological characteristics. Fingerprint scanning, facial recognition, and voice authentication provide stronger security while enhancing user convenience. Behavioral biometrics analyze typing patterns, mouse movements, and device handling to continuously verify user identity throughout sessions. Multi-modal biometric systems combine multiple authentication factors for enhanced security, making account takeover attacks significantly more difficult. However, biometric systems must address privacy concerns, spoofing attacks, and the challenge of biometric data storage.
